We, the students of USD 305, know that Digg.com is a neccesary resource students need for current events. The media in this day and age is highly corrupted. They cloud our view of what is really happening in the world. For example, certain news outlets obviously lean towards specific presidential candidates. On Digg, the world decides what news is important, not elitists. Kindly unblock Digg.com so that our student body can be appropriately informed of news.
